Just rang up BT, in India I assume, was told I could log nuisance calls but needed to keep ringing their 151 number to log these everytime. The man said that I could always use the ringback and BT would call me back within the hour!
Years ago I remember getting a code to use after I had put the phone down on the nuisance caller and keypressed this number in. Has this efficiency gone? Do I need to ring and wait 20 mins to get through to a 151 than wait even longer to have this understood and logged with BT? Seems that something is missing in protecting the customers. Any advice anyone?

You can dial 1477 during or immediately after a malicious call to record the callers actual number so that it can be traced. See http://btbusiness.custhelp.com/app/answers/detail/a_id/9311/~/tracing-a-call
